Understanding Dubai’s Climate Before You Travel
Dubai has a desert climate, meaning sunshine is almost guaranteed throughout the year. However, temperatures and humidity levels vary significantly depending on the season. Winters are mild and pleasant, summers are hot and humid, and spring and autumn act as transitional periods. Knowing how each season feels helps travellers from the UK plan activities comfortably and pack accordingly. From outdoor adventures to beach relaxation and city sightseeing, the right season determines what you’ll enjoy most.
Winter Season (November to March) – Best Overall Time
Winter is widely considered the best time to visit Dubai. Temperatures usually range between 17°C and 30°C, making it ideal for outdoor activities like desert safaris, city tours, and beach outings. The pleasant weather allows visitors to explore attractions comfortably without worrying about heat exhaustion.
This is also peak tourist season, meaning events, festivals, and shopping carnivals take place across the city. While prices may be slightly higher, the experience is unmatched because the weather is perfect for sightseeing, photography, and adventure excursions.
Spring Season (April to May) – Balanced Weather and Deals
Spring offers a balance between pleasant weather and reasonable prices. Temperatures begin to rise but remain manageable, especially during mornings and evenings. This is a great time for travellers who want fewer crowds while still enjoying outdoor attractions.
Hotels and airlines often offer discounts during this period, making it a good opportunity for travellers seeking value-for-money trips. Visitors can explore landmarks, enjoy waterparks, or take evening cruises without the peak-season rush.
Summer Season (June to August) – Budget-Friendly Travel
Dubai summers are hot, with temperatures sometimes exceeding 40°C. While outdoor activities during the daytime may be limited, the city is well equipped for indoor tourism. Shopping malls, aquariums, theme parks, and entertainment venues are air-conditioned and comfortable.
This is the best time for budget travellers because hotel rates and flight prices drop significantly. Many travellers choose Dubai Holiday Packages during summer to take advantage of discounted luxury stays and exclusive indoor experiences.
Autumn Season (September to October) – Shoulder Season Advantage
Autumn is another good time to visit Dubai, especially for travellers who want pleasant weather without peak tourist crowds. Temperatures gradually cool down, and outdoor activities become more enjoyable again. Beaches, desert tours, and sightseeing tours are comfortable, particularly during mornings and evenings.
This season is ideal for travellers who prefer a relaxed pace, moderate prices, and fewer queues at attractions.
Best Month-by-Month Breakdown
- November–February: Perfect weather, festivals, and events.
- March: Warm but comfortable sightseeing conditions.
- April–May: Good deals with tolerable heat.
- June–August: Hot but cheapest travel period.
- September–October: Transition months with improving weather.
Choosing the right month depends on whether you prioritise budget, weather, or crowd levels.
Best Time for Specific Travel Interests
- For Sightseeing: November to March offers the best climate for exploring landmarks and outdoor attractions.
- For Shopping: January and February host shopping festivals with huge discounts.
- For Beaches: March, April, October, and November provide warm water and pleasant temperatures.
- For Budget Trips: June to August offers the lowest prices on flights and hotels.
Understanding your travel priority helps you pick the perfect travel window.
Travel Tips for UK Visitors
Travellers from the UK should prepare differently depending on the season. In winter, light jackets are enough for evenings, while summer requires breathable clothing, sunscreen, and hydration. Booking flights in advance often results in better fares, especially during peak months.
It’s also wise to plan activities ahead of time, especially popular attractions, desert tours, and dinner cruises. Early planning ensures availability and avoids last-minute price surges.
